The Stiebel Eltron WPL-A 07 HK 230 Premium is a monobloc air source heat pump for outdoor installation from Stiebel Eltron's Premium platform, using the low-GWP R454C refrigerant rather than the R290 used across the HPA-O range. It delivers 6.87 kW at A-7/W35, a Seasonal COP of 4.88 at 35 °C, and flow temperatures up to 75 °C — suitable for retrofit properties running on radiators as well as new-build underfloor systems. This is the same heat pump used across Stiebel Eltron's WPL-A Premium kit range (Pack 1–3 and the Premium Compact Set).

Electrical and unvented cylinder compliance
Electrical connection must be carried out by a competent electrician to Part P and BS 7671, and grid-connected units require a DNO notification (G98/G99) prior to commissioning. Cylinder installation must meet G3 Building Regulations for unvented hot water storage.
Key features
Inverter technology
Variable-speed inverter compressor delivers high efficiency and low energy bills across the operating range.
Low noise, with silent mode
Intelligent appliance design keeps noise emissions low, with a night-time "silent mode" available for further reduction.
Heating and active cooling
Provides cooling in summer months in addition to heating and DHW support.
High flow temperature for retrofit
Flow temperatures up to 75°C give first-rate hot water convenience and support existing radiator circuits in older buildings.
Low-GWP R454C refrigerant
Uses R454C, with a Global Warming Potential of under 150 — over ten times lower than legacy refrigerants used across much of the heat pump market.
Smart, app-based control
Optional integration into the home network and smartphone control (additional components required).

Help us prepare your custom quote
Because Stiebel Eltron configurations are matched to the property, please have the following ready when requesting a quote:
- System configuration – will the heat pump run as a stand-alone heat source, or in a bivalent arrangement alongside an existing boiler or secondary heat source?
- Hot water demand – what is the expected DHW usage volume for the property (occupants, bathrooms, peak draw-off), or is DHW production not required?
- Hydraulic layout – does the property use an S-plan or Y-plan hydraulic arrangement, or another zoned configuration?
- Pre-plumbed preference – would a pre-plumbed cylinder/buffer assembly be preferred to reduce on-site installation time?
- Secondary return – does the property require a secondary return circulation loop for the DHW system?
- Installation restrictions – are there any size or positioning restrictions for the outdoor unit or indoor cylinder?
- Electrical supply – is a single-phase or three-phase power supply available at the property?
- Pump groups – how many pump groups are required downstream of the buffer on the secondary (heating distribution) side?
- Control logic – should the system be controlled by the OEM heat pump manager, or integrated with a third-party room thermostat/BMS via Modbus or KNX?
